Comprehending the 30ft Container
A 30ft shipping container is an intermediate size that fits between the more typical 20ft and 40ft containers. Although less widespread, it uses a remarkable variety of applications that can deal with different service requirements.
Specs
Length: 30 ft shipping containers feet (approximately 9.1 meters).
Width: 8 feet (approximately 2.44 meters).
Height: 8.5 feet (requirement) or 9.5 feet (high cube).
Volume: Approximately 2,390 cubic feet (requirement); higher in high-cube variants.
Weight: A common empty 30ft container weighs around 3,000 - 4,000 lbs (about 1,360 - 1,800 kg) depending upon the product and construction.

Upkeep and Care.
Despite their robust design, regular upkeep is essential for the longevity of a 30ft container:.
Rust Prevention: Regularly inspect for signs of rust and use anti-rust treatments as essential.
Structural Checks: Periodically look for dents or damages that could affect the container's stability.
Tidiness: Keep the interior tidy and dry to prevent mold and mildew, particularly in storage applications.
Frequently asked questions.
1. Just how much weight can a 30ft container hold?
A standard 30ft container normally has a maximum gross weight limitation of around 27,000 lbs (around 12,200 kg), but this can differ based on the container's building and style.

5. What is the life-span of a 30ft Container 30Ft?
Depending upon maintenance and use, a quality shipping container can last anywhere from 10 to 25 years.
